The Big Leagues: Where the Champions Reign Supreme

San Antonio boasts one major league team, and let me tell you, they're a doozy. The San Antonio Spurs (NBA) are legendary for their killer defense, smooth teamwork, and a trophy cabinet overflowing with five NBA championships. Home to superstars (both past and present) like Tim Duncan, Manu Ginobili, and Tony Parker, the Spurs will have you yelling "Go Spurs Go!" until your voice is hoarse.

The Minors: Where Legends Are Born (and Tacos Are Always Available)

San Antonio's minor league scene is hotter than a habanero pepper! Here's a taste of what you'll find:

  • San Antonio FC (USL): These soccer stars will have you chanting "Ol�, Ol�, Ol�!" faster than you can say "Schweinsteiger." They're known for their fancy footwork and their equally fancy post-game celebrations (hint: it involves a whole lot of confetti).
  • San Antonio Missions (MiLB): Baseball with a side of nachos? Yes, please! The Missions are a Double-A affiliate, which means you get to see future major leaguers before they hit the big time. Plus, minor league games are way more affordable, leaving you with extra cash for churros.

Bonus: Keep an eye out for the San Antonio Brahmas (XFL), a professional football team that just started making waves in 2021. They might not be the NFL yet, but they sure know how to put on a show!
